Game Overview

In 1990, Probe Software Ltd. released an exciting addition to the Dan Dare series, capturing the intergalactic escapades of one of Britain’s favorite comic book heroes. This installment is notable for taking players on a thrilling journey as they step into the role of Dan Dare, the dedicated pilot of the futuristic spaceship Anastasia, in his quest to thwart his arch-nemesis, the Mekon.

Gameplay and Features

The game is set across multiple visually diverse levels that challenge players with a mix of platforming puzzles and frantic combat scenarios. Players need to navigate treacherous environments, collecting objects and overcoming obstacles with precision and strategy. The levels are well-crafted, offering a blend of exploration and action that was characteristic of the early 90s gaming scene.

Historical Context

The release of this game occurred at a time when video game technology was evolving rapidly, transitioning from 8-bit to 16-bit graphics. It was developed for various platforms including the Amiga, Atari ST, and ZX Spectrum, offering varied experiences depending on the system. While it didn’t revolutionize gaming, it did capture the spirit of the era, utilizing available technology to immerse players in its universe.

Legacy

Although not as prominent as some of its contemporaries, the game enjoys a nostalgic place in the hearts of fans who grew up with the Dan Dare comics and early video games. Its release bolstered the profile of Probe Software Ltd., which would later go on to develop other notable titles. This project contributed to the studio’s reputation as proficient developers within the constraints of the period’s technology.
